Headquartered in Hoboken, New Jersey, the company operates in two primary segments: Research and Learning. The Research segment provides scientific, technical, medical, and scholarly journals, along with related content and services in fields such as physical sciences, health sciences, social sciences, humanities, and life sciences. Its customers include research libraries, library consortia, researchers, and professional society members. The Learning segment offers scientific, professional, and educational print and digital books, digital courseware for students and instructors, and assessment services for businesses and professionals. Products are distributed through various channels including brick-and-mortar stores, online retailers, wholesalers, college bookstores, and direct sales to corporations and government agencies. Wiley has a significant global presence in the US, UK, China, Japan, Australia, and internationally. The company went public in 1962 and is listed on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ker WLY. As of the latest data, Wiley employs approximately 4,500–5,000 people worldwide. The company has a strong focus on digital transformation, leveraging data-driven insights and knowledge services to advance science, innovation, and learning. Financially, Wiley has shown robust profitability with a gross profit margin of around 74%, an operating margin of approximately 15–16%, and a net profit margin near 13%. The company generates significant free cash flow, supporting its dividend payments and investment in future growth. Leadership has transitioned over time; as of the most recent announcement, Matthew Kissner serves as President and CEO, succeeding Brian A. Napack. Wiley's mission is to unlock human potential by providing authoritative content and digital solutions that empower individuals to achieve their goals in education and professional development.
